GB vs API and ASME Valve Standards: Complete Cross-Reference Guide
Why a Cross-Reference Is Needed
Chinese manufacturers supply a large share of the world's industrial valves, and their catalogues cite GB and JB standards that most Western engineers have never had to read. The question that follows a quotation is always the same: is this valve equivalent to what my specification requires?
Usually the design standard is equivalent. Often the dimensions are not. This guide separates the two.
Design Standards Cross-Reference
| Scope | Chinese standard | International equivalent |
|---|---|---|
| Steel valves, general requirements | GB/T 12224 | ASME B16.34 |
| Face-to-face dimensions | GB/T 12221 | ASME B16.10, ISO 5752 |
| Valve marking | GB/T 12220 | MSS SP-25 |
| Bolted bonnet steel gate valves | GB/T 12234 | API 600, ISO 10434 |
| Compact steel gate valves | JB/T 7746 | API 602, ISO 15761 |
| Steel globe and lift check valves | GB/T 12235 | BS 1873, API 623 |
| Steel swing check valves | GB/T 12236 | BS 1868 |
| Steel ball valves | GB/T 12237 | API 608, ISO 17292, BS 5351 |
| Flanged and wafer butterfly valves | GB/T 12238 | API 609, EN 593, MSS SP-67 |
| Metal-seated butterfly valves | JB/T 8527 | MSS SP-68 |
| Pressure testing | GB/T 13927 | API 598, ISO 5208, EN 12266 |
| Inspection and testing | GB/T 26480 | API 598 |
| Nuclear valves | GB/T 19624 | ASME III, RCC-M |
| Valve model coding | GB/T 32808 | No direct equivalent |
The most important entry is the first gate valve row. GB/T 12234 is an equivalent adoption of API 600. Wall thickness, bonnet bolting, stem retention and trim requirements are aligned. A supplier claiming "GB/T 12234 compliant" is claiming API 600 design practice, and that claim is verifiable against the same criteria.
Flange and Dimensional Standards
| Scope | Chinese standard | Follows the geometry of |
|---|---|---|
| Steel pipe flanges (metric) | GB/T 9113 | EN 1092-1 |
| Large diameter flanges | GB/T 13402 | ASME B16.47 |
| Petrochemical flanges | HG/T 20592 series | EN 1092-1 |
| Petrochemical flanges (Class series) | HG/T 20615 series | ASME B16.5 |
This is where projects go wrong. A Chinese valve can be fully API 600 equivalent in design and still not bolt onto your pipe, because the metric flange series follows European geometry.
At DN100, GB/T 9113 PN16 gives a 220 mm outside diameter on a 180 mm bolt circle. ASME B16.5 Class 150 gives 228.6 mm on a 190.5 mm bolt circle. The design standard is irrelevant if the bolt holes do not line up. Our PN vs ASME Class guide sets out the full dimensional comparison.
The practical fix is straightforward: specify the flange standard separately and explicitly in the purchase order. Chinese manufacturers routinely produce both HG/T 20615 (ASME geometry) and GB/T 9113 (EN geometry) lines. You have to say which one you want.
Material Grade Cross-Reference
| Form | ASTM / ASME | Chinese GB | EN | JIS |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Carbon steel forging | A105 | 20 steel | P245GH (1.0352) | SFVC1 |
| Carbon steel casting | A216 WCB | WCB / ZG230-450 | GP240GH (1.0619) | SCPH2 |
| 304 stainless forging | A182 F304 | 06Cr19Ni10 | 1.4301 | SUS304 |
| 316 stainless forging | A182 F316 | 06Cr17Ni12Mo2 | 1.4401 | SUS316 |
| 304 stainless casting | A351 CF8 | ZG07Cr19Ni9 | 1.4308 | SCS13A |
| 316 stainless casting | A351 CF8M | ZG07Cr19Ni11Mo2 | 1.4408 | SCS14A |
| Cr-Mo alloy steel | A182 F5 | 1Cr5Mo | 1.7362 | SCPH32 |
These are the commonly cited equivalences, and they are close enough for most commercial service. They are not identical. Composition tolerance bands, permitted residual elements and impact test requirements differ between standards. For sour service under NACE MR0175, for cryogenic duty, or for any code-stamped application, require the actual mill certificate rather than relying on an equivalence table. Testing and Acceptance Differences
GB/T 13927 corresponds to API 598, but the two are not word-for-word identical. Points worth writing into the purchase order:
- Test duration requirements differ by size and valve type between the two documents.
- Allowable seat leakage for metal-seated valves is defined on different bases; do not assume a GB shell and seat test certificate satisfies an API 598 requirement without checking the numbers.
- High pressure gas seat test is optional in some GB pathways and mandatory in certain API applications.
If your specification says API 598, ask for testing to API 598 explicitly. Most competent Chinese manufacturers can and will do it. They will not do it by default if the order only cites GB.

A Four-Step Verification Routine

- Map the design standard using the table above, and ask for the specific GB clause if the equivalence matters contractually.
- Verify the flange standard separately. Design equivalence does not imply dimensional interchangeability. This is the single most common failure point.
- Specify the test standard by name in the order, along with required certificates (material, pressure test, and third-party inspection if applicable).
Where This Leaves You
Chinese GB standards are, for mainstream valve types, technically aligned with API and ISO practice. The engineering risk is rarely in the design standard. It is in the interface details: flange geometry, test acceptance criteria, and material certification depth.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is GB/T 12234 the same as API 600?
GB/T 12234 is an equivalent adoption of API 600 and ISO 10434 for bolted bonnet steel gate valves. Wall thickness, bonnet bolting, stem retention and trim requirements are aligned, so a compliant GB/T 12234 valve follows API 600 design practice.
Which Chinese standard corresponds to API 608 ball valves?
GB/T 12237 covers steel ball valves for petroleum, petrochemical and related industries, corresponding to API 608, ISO 17292 and BS 5351.
Can I bolt a Chinese GB/T 9113 flange to ASME B16.5 piping?
No. GB/T 9113 metric flanges follow EN 1092-1 geometry. At DN100 the bolt circle is 180 mm against 190.5 mm for ASME B16.5 Class 150, so the holes do not align. Specify HG/T 20615 if you need ASME flange geometry from a Chinese supplier.
What is the Chinese equivalent of ASTM A105?
Chinese 20 steel is the commonly cited equivalent of A105 carbon steel forging, alongside EN P245GH (1.0352) and JIS SFVC1. Composition tolerances differ slightly, so request the mill certificate for critical service.
Does a GB/T 13927 test certificate satisfy an API 598 requirement?
Not automatically. GB/T 13927 corresponds to API 598 but test durations and metal seat leakage acceptance criteria are defined differently. If the specification requires API 598, state that explicitly in the purchase order.
Which Chinese standard covers valve face-to-face dimensions?
GB/T 12221 covers structural length for metal valves and corresponds to ASME B16.10 and ISO 5752.
